DYE SUB

Dye sublimation is a high-quality digital printing method that uses heat to transfer dye onto polyester fabrics or coated surfaces. The process begins by printing the design onto special transfer paper using sublimation inks. When heat and pressure are applied, the ink turns into gas and bonds with the fabric at a molecular level, resulting in vibrant, permanent prints that won’t crack, peel, or fade. This technique is ideal for producing full-color, edge-to-edge designs with photographic detail. Because the dye becomes part of the fabric, the final product maintains a soft, breathable feel- perfect for sportswear, fashion, flags, and promotional items. Dye sublimation works best on light-colored, synthetic materials like polyester and is not suitable for cotton or dark fabrics without special treatment.

EMBROIDERY

Embroidery printing is a premium decoration method that uses thread to stitch designs directly onto fabric, offering a timeless, durable, and textured finish. Unlike ink-based printing, embroidery involves digitizing a design and using specialized machines to sew it onto garments with precision. This technique is ideal for logos, monograms, and branding elements that require a professional, high-end look. Embroidery works best on thicker fabrics like cotton, denim, fleece, and canvas, and is commonly used for hats, polos, jackets, and uniforms. Because the thread becomes part of the garment, embroidery is highly resistant to fading, peeling, or cracking - even after repeated washing. It adds a tactile, dimensional quality that elevates the perceived value of the product. While it’s less suited for complex gradients or photographic detail, embroidery excels at clean, bold designs with strong lines and solid colors.

SCREEN PRINTING

Screen printing is a traditional and widely used method for applying designs to textiles and other surfaces by pushing ink through a mesh screen onto the material. Each color in the design requires a separate screen, making it ideal for bold, graphic prints with solid colors. This technique is known for its durability, vibrant color output, and ability to produce consistent results across large quantities. It works best on cotton and other natural fabrics, and is commonly used for t-shirts, hoodies, tote bags, and promotional items. Screen printing is especially cost-effective for bulk orders and simple designs, though it’s less suited for complex gradients or photographic detail. The ink sits on top of the fabric, creating a slightly raised texture that adds to its visual and tactile appeal.

LASER

Laser printing is a fast, precise, and efficient method of producing high-quality text and graphics using a laser beam and toner powder. Commonly used in office and commercial settings, laser printers work by projecting a laser onto a photosensitive drum to create an electrostatic image. Toner particles are then attracted to this image and fused onto paper using heat. This technique is known for its sharp resolution, clean lines, and smudge-resistant output. It’s ideal for printing documents, labels, and monochrome or color graphics with consistent quality. Laser printing is especially cost-effective for high-volume jobs, offering quick turnaround and low per-page costs compared to inkjet alternatives. While not typically used for fabric or textured surfaces, laser printing excels in producing crisp, professional results on standard paper and specialty media. UV

UV is a cutting-edge digital printing method that uses ultraviolet light to instantly cure ink on a wide range of surfaces, producing vibrant, durable, and high-resolution prints. Unlike traditional printing, which relies on heat or air drying, UV printing uses specially formulated inks that are exposed to UV light immediately after application. This rapid curing process locks the ink in place, preventing smudging and allowing for sharp, detailed results on materials like plastic, glass, wood, metal, acrylic, and coated paper. UV printing is widely used in packaging, signage, promotional products, electronics, and custom merchandise. Its versatility and precision make it ideal for both short-run and high-volume applications

VINYL

Vinyl is a flexible, durable substrate widely used in printing for both indoor and outdoor applications. Its smooth, non-porous surface allows for vivid color reproduction and sharp detail, making it ideal for banners, decals, vehicle wraps, wall graphics, and promotional signage. Vinyl is weather-resistant and can withstand moisture, UV exposure, and temperature changes, ensuring long-lasting performance in demanding environments. Available in gloss, matte, transparent, and textured finishes, vinyl adapts easily to various surfaces and shapes-offering a reliable canvas for bold, high-impact visuals.

CARDBOARD

Cardboard is a lightweight yet sturdy substrate widely used in packaging, signage, and display printing. Its fibrous, porous surface supports techniques like offset printing, flexography, and screen printing-delivering bold colors and crisp graphics with excellent ink absorption. Available in various thicknesses and finishes (e.g., corrugated, coated, kraft), cardboard offers versatility for both structural and aesthetic applications. Whether used for retail boxes, promotional stands, or eco-friendly packaging, printed cardboard combines affordability with visual impact and recyclability.
